Jump to How social...Dec 19, 2022 · Scotch whisky is often considered the benchmark of quality whisky, and its distillation is strictly regulated. There are several categories of Scotch, but all must be distilled in Scotland and aged in oak barrels for at least three years. The most common categories of Scotch are single malt, single grain, blended malt, and blended grain. A blended malt Scotch whisky is made from 2 or more single-malt whiskies produced at different distilleries. X Research source Many distilleries sell their whisky for use in blends. Scotch whisky must retain the color, aroma, and taste of the raw materials used in, and the method of, its production and maturation. 3. Scotch whisky may not contain any added substances, aside from water and plain (E150A) caramel coloring. 4. Scotch whisky must comprise a minimum alcoholic strength by volume of 40% (80 US proof). In the US, many are made at home.Scotch whisky: made in Scotland from malted barley and aged for at least three years in oak casks. Canadian whisky: often made from a blend of different grains, such as corn, wheat, and rye, and aged in oak barrels. In order to be officially called Scotch whisky: The spirit needs to mature in oak for at least three years. Production and maturation must take place in Scotland.
